[email protected] wrote: > Full_Name: Mat Booth > Version: 2.4.31 > OS: Windows XP > URL: > http://people.apache.org/~mbooth/0001-Changes-required-to-build-with-Microsoft-Visual-Stud.patch > Submission from: (NULL) (77.86.30.139) > > > The provided patch makes three changes that were necessary for me to build > liblber and libldap on Windows using Microsoft Visual Studio. > > > * include/ac/socket.h > The type socklen_t is defined in ws2tcpip.h on the Windows platform, so > include > this header when including winsock2.h > > * libraries/libldap/ldap-int.h > The struct timeval is defined in winsock.h or winsock2.h on the Windows > platform > so include ac/socket.h when _WIN32 is defined (The comment in winsock2.h > literary says "taken from the BSD file sys/time.h") > > * libraries/libldap/util-int.c > The error code EAI_SYSTEM is not defined at all on the Windows platform, so > only > use it if it's defined. > > > > The attached patch file is derived from OpenLDAP Software.
